SUPPORTIVE & REASSURING

At Elaris, people often come to us because they’re experiencing more than one layer of difficulty. Sometimes it starts with a pain in the back or neck. Other times it’s fatigue, tension, or stress that seems to have no clear cause.

Musculoskeletal and Postural Concerns

   •   Back pain (including sciatica)

   •   Neck pain and stiffness

• Disc Injury

  •   Headaches and migraines

   •   Shoulder, hip, or knee pain

   •   Postural strain from work, driving, or screens

   •   Sports or repetitive strain injuries

Stress-Related and Psychoneurophysiological Concerns

   •   Tension that never seems to go away

   •   Sleep disturbance or difficulty switching off

   •   Anxiety, overwhelm, or feeling “stuck”

   •   Fatigue that lingers even with rest

   •   Physical pain that worsens during stress

Psychoneuro-Related Digestive and Visceral-Linked Concerns

   •   Heartburn or indigestion

   •   Bloating

• IBS-type symptoms

• Constipation

   •   Tension felt in the stomach or chest when stressed

Psychoneuro- Related Reproductive and Hormonal Concerns

   •   Menstrual discomfort

   •   Perimenopausal symptoms such as

• Sleep changes

• Fatigue, or mood swings

   •   Pelvic tension or post-partum recovery

Other Concerns People Mention

   •   Feeling disconnected from their body

   •   Low energy or “brain fog”

   •   A sense that past experiences still affect their health today
